B & G's #154 9/26/09
Baltimore Orioles (60-93) Vs Cleveland Indians (62-91) At Progressive Field in Cleveland, Ohio Saturday September 26Th, 2009
Jason Berken (5-12, 6.41) Vs Jeremy Sowers (6-10, 4.92) Final Score: Cleveland 9, Baltimore 8 W- Kerry Wood (3-3) L- Jim Johnson (4-6)
Baseballs:
**Jhonny Peralta- Jhonny picked up a walk off single, he went 3-5 and drove in 2 runs with a double. He has 80 RBIs and is hitting .264.
**Andy Marte- Andy went 1-3 with a sacrifice fly, he drove in 3 runs with his 6Th Home Run of the season, he has 22 RBIs and is hitting .254.
**Shin-Soo Choo- Choo went 2-5, he hit his 18Th Home Run of the year, drove in his 82Nd RBI and is hitting .304.
**Lou Marson- I am starting to like Lou more and more every game he plays. He went 2-4 with a double and is hitting .240.
**Trevor Crowe- Trevor went 2-4 at the plate, he is hitting .241.
**Luis Valbuena- Luis went 2-5 at the plate, he drove in 2 runs giving him 29 RBIs. He is hitting .241.
**Asdrubal Cabrera- Asdrubal led off in the game, he went 2-5 and drove in his 65Th run. He is hitting .303.
**Travis Hafner- Pronk went 1-3 with a walk and is hitting .271.
**Rafael Perez- He was in line to win the game, threw 1 1/3 scoreless innings, he walked 1, struck out 3 and he lowered his ERA to 6.95.
**Chris Perez- Chris threw 2/3 scoreless innings, earning his 7Th hold and he has a 4.36 ERA.
**Luke Scott- Luke went 3-5 at the plate, he hit his 25Th Home Run of the season, drove in 3 runs, giving him 76 RBIs. Luke is hitting .259.
**Michael Aubrey- Michael again hurt his former team, he went 2-3, he hit his 2Nd Home Run of the season, drove in his 8Th run and is hitting .339.
**Robert Andino- Robert went 1-4, he hit his 2Nd Home Run, drove in his 10Th run and is hitting .225.
**Matt Wieters- Matt went 2-4 with a walk, he drove in his 39Th run of the season and is hitting .289.
**Brian Roberts- Brian went 2-4 with a walk, he is hitting .289.
**Chris Waters- Chris threw 1 1/3 scoreless innings, keeping the Orioles in the game. He now has a 8.10 ERA.
**Cla Meredith- Cla threw a scoreless inning, he earned his 2Nd hold of the year and now has a 4.14 ERA.
**Danys Baez- Baez threw a scoreless 8Th inning, he has a 4.17 ERA.
Goofballs:
**Jim Johnson- Blew the save and lost his 6Th game of the season. He gave up 1 run (1 earned) in 1/3 of an inning and has a 4.16 ERA.
**Jason Berken- He had some trouble, only lasting 3 2/3 innings, giving up 4 runs (4 earned), he didn't walk anyone, struck out 3, gave up 2 Home Runs. He has a 6.51 ERA with a no decision.
**Sean Henn- Sean blew the lead, he didn't retire anyone, giving up 3 runs (3 earned), he walked 1, didn't strike anyone out and has a 7.53 ERA.
**Chris Ray- Chris threw an inning, giving up 1 run (1 earned), he walked 1, didn't strike anyone out and has a 6.54.
**Kerry Wood- Blew his 6Th save of the season. He threw 1 inning, gave up 2 runs (2 earned), he walked 1, didn't strike anyone out and has a 4.33 ERA. But he did pick up his 3rd win of the season, thanks to his offense scoring the winning run.
**Jeremy Sowers- Again, he blew up in the 5Th inning. 4 shutout innings, gave up 5 runs in the 5Th. So he threw 5 innings, giving up 5 runs (5 earned), he walked 4, struck out 3 and has a 5.09 ERA.
**Jensen Lewis- Threw an inning and gave up a Home Run. So he gave up 1 run (1 earned) and has a 4.38 ERA.

It's always good to see the Indians come back from adversity, but again their opponents were the Baltimore Orioles, a team that was struggling just as much as the Indians. However, they got swept by the Athletics, another team struggling, so we'll take this. The Indians will now get a chance to sweep the Orioles on Sunday afternoon. Game starts at 1:05 PM, airing on STO, with Indians On Deck at 12:30 PM. Chris Tillman (2-4, 4.71) will take on David Huff (10-8, 5.98).
